Hey I have this question:

I've been goofing around a bit with arena battles with a friend.

Now I've been looking at the arena vendors, and I noticed vengeful gloves (season 3 I think, don't know too much about all the ranks) are only 1100 arena points, which we almost have.

Is there any reason -besides another set's full set bonusses- not to buy these instead of regular honor epic gloves? I've seen the season 2 gloves for 900 points so the difference is minimal, why would anyone buy the season 2 gloves when they are only 200 points cheaper :?

Thing is I still see alot of people in season 2 arena gear while season 4 is already on is way.

Maybe a stupid question lol, I havn't been 70 for too long. :P

S3 has a PR requirement in arena before you can buy it, and it's doubtful (unless you're a lock) you'll reach that PR without S2 or at least tier / tier-like (if you're one of the 2 classes that can use PvE armor in arena viably).
